Retool

Retool is a software company that provides a platform for building internal tools quickly and efficiently. Founded in June 2017 by CEO David Hsu, the company aims to simplify the development and scaling of mission-critical applications. Retools platform reduces redundant coding by offering a suite of tools and components that can be easily integrated, helping businesses streamline operations and improve productivity. Retool serves a diverse range of notable customers, including Amazon, Mercedes-Benz, Doordash, NFL, NBC, Rakuten, Brex, Lyft, Plaid, and Coinbase. These companies utilize Retools solutions to manage their internal tools effectively. Since its inception, Retool has experienced significant growth, reaching an annual recurring revenue of approximately $80 million by 2022 and processing billions of queries across over 500,000 apps built on its platform. With a valuation of $3.2 billion, Retool continues to solidify its position as a leader in the tech industry.
